Citations
1 citation on file for this inspection.
1910.147 D
- Issued
- Aug 2, 2019
- Abate by
- Aug 27, 2019
- Penalty
- Initial $13,260 · Current $6,630 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.147(d): The established procedure for the application of energy control (the lockout or tagout procedures) covered the following elements, however, the actions were not done in sequence as required by 29 CFR 1910.147 (d)(1)-(6): a) On or about March 28, 2019 the employer did not ensure that employees utilized energy control procedures prior to clearing a jammed pallet in the hoist area of the line N palletizer. The energy source was not isolated prior to engaging in these activities. As a result, the remaining applicable energy control elements, involving machine isolation [1910.147(d)(3)], lock-out/tag-out device application [1910.147(d)(4)], dissipation of residual energy [1910.147(d)(5)], and verification of isolation [1910.147(d)(6)], were not implemented to protect employees from machine servicing hazards such as, but not limited to, pallet unjamming.
